Output d81f8dd6524c9f012f369d54c22241704b62f534af8bea57ed6bb55cfec4163b:3

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ed27cc7ac1858c57610e6155e946b93af2fce4ef OP_EQUAL
address
3PJykGnpxePWTZ912h9KhN5XW2kG5Bmjg3
transaction
d81f8dd6524c9f012f369d54c22241704b62f534af8bea57ed6bb55cfec4163b
confirmations
398998
spent
true